This ensures the content is always on screen, but also accounts for the
fact that scroll operations without animation were actually forcing the
local score to a location it can't usually reside at.
Basically, the local score was in the scroll extension region (due to always trying
to scroll the local player to the middle of the display, but there being
no other content below the local player to scroll up by).
